Your browser will remember form information and use it for your convenience on other websites. You have probably filled in these fields before on a different website and it's not something specific to warframe.

This is seperate from clearing out your cookies and browsing history and It's not something to worry about unless you're on a shared computer. You can change preferences on form autofill if you're uncomfortable, here is a link to the Firefox FAQ page on the subject.
